@Stability(value=Stable) public static final class CfnDomain.AdvancedSecurityOptionsInputProperty.Builder extends Object implements software.amazon.jsii.Builder<CfnDomain.AdvancedSecurityOptionsInputProperty>
CfnDomain.AdvancedSecurityOptionsInputProperty| Constructor and Description |
|---|
Builder() |
@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der anonymousAuthEnabled(Boolean anonymousAuthEnabled)
CfnDomain.AdvancedSecurityOptionsInputProperty.getAnonymousAuthEnabled()anonymousAuthEnabled - `CfnDomain.AdvancedSecurityOptionsInputProperty.AnonymousAuthEnabled`.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der anonymousAuthEnabled(IResolvable anonymousAuthEnabled)
CfnDomain.AdvancedSecurityOptionsInputProperty.getAnonymousAuthEnabled()anonymousAuthEnabled - `CfnDomain.AdvancedSecurityOptionsInputProperty.AnonymousAuthEnabled`.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der enabled(Boolean enabled)
CfnDomain.AdvancedSecurityOptionsInputProperty.getEnabled()enabled - True to enable fine-grained access control.
You must also enable encryption of data at rest and node-to-node encryption.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der enabled(IResolvable enabled)
CfnDomain.AdvancedSecurityOptionsInputProperty.getEnabled()enabled - True to enable fine-grained access control.
You must also enable encryption of data at rest and node-to-node encryption.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der internalUserDatabaseEnabled(Boolean internalUserDatabaseEnabled)
internalUserDatabaseEnabled - True to enable the internal user database.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der internalUserDatabaseEnabled(IResolvable internalUserDatabaseEnabled)
internalUserDatabaseEnabled - True to enable the internal user database.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der masterUserOptions(IResolvable masterUserOptions)
CfnDomain.AdvancedSecurityOptionsInputProperty.getMasterUserOptions()masterUserOptions - Specifies information about the master user.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ty.Builder masterUserOptions(CfnDomain.MasterUserOptionsProperty masterUserOptions)
CfnDomain.AdvancedSecurityOptionsInputProperty.getMasterUserOptions()masterUserOptions - Specifies information about the master user.this@Stability(value=Stable) public CfnDomain.AdvancedSecurityOptionsInputProperty build()
build in interface software.amazon.jsii.Builder<CfnDomain.AdvancedSecurityOptionsInputProperty>CfnDomain.AdvancedSecurityOptionsInputPropertyNullPointerException - if any required attribute was not providedCopyright © 2022. All rights reserved.